site stats

Simplex algorithm time complexity

http://www.maths.lse.ac.uk/Personal/stengel/savani.pdf Webbt t t t Algorithms: forms of analysis • How to devise an algorithm • How to validate the algorithm is correct – Correctness proofs • How to analyze running time and space of algorithm – Complexity analysis: asymptotic, empirical, others • How to choose or modify an algorithm to solve a problem • How to implement and test an algorithm in a program

Lower and Upper Bound Theory - GeeksforGeeks

WebbWe generally consider the worst-time complexity as it is the maximum time taken for any given input size. Space complexity: An algorithm's space complexity is the amount of space required to solve a problem and produce an output. Similar to the time complexity, space complexity is also expressed in big O notation. Webbthe expected running time of variants of the simplex method by Adler and Megiddo [1], Borgwardt [3], and Smale [23]. Later, in seminal work, Spielman and Teng [25] de ned the concept of smoothed analysis and showed that the simplex algorithm has polynomial smoothed complexity. 2. PRELIMINARIES Markov decision processes. irc ordinary income https://rodrigo-brito.com

An Introduction to the Time Complexity of Algorithms - FreeCodecamp

WebbInterestingly enough, it turns out it encapsulates both the MMCC and primal network simplex algorithms as extreme cases. By guiding the solution using a particular expansion scheme, we are able to recuperate theoretical results from MMCC. As such, we obtain a strongly polynomial Contraction-Expansion algorithm which runs in O(m3n2) time. Webbhave time complexities of 0(n3). Our analysis is closely related to Cunningham's analysis of antistall-ing pivot rules for the primal network simplex algo-rithm. However, by focusing on the permanent labeling aspect of the SPS algorithm we are able to prove that these variants require at most (n - 1) * (n - 2)/2 simplex pivots, and that this ... WebbIn this paper we briefly review what is known about the worst-case complexity of variants of the simplex method for both general linear programs and network flow problems and … order by 和 group by顺序

A novel hybrid arithmetic optimization algorithm for solving ...

Category:Performance evaluation of a novel improved slime mould algorithm …

Tags:Simplex algorithm time complexity

Simplex algorithm time complexity

ds.algorithms - Complexity of the simplex algorithm - Theoretical

http://cs-www.cs.yale.edu/homes/spielman/Research/cacmSmooth.pdf Webb10 apr. 2024 · Anatomy and Physiology Chemistry Physics Social Science Political Science. ASK AN EXPERT. Math Advanced Math Maximize P = 5x − y subject to x − y ≤ −2, 3x + y ≤ 3, x, y ≥ 0 using the simplex method.

Simplex algorithm time complexity

Did you know?

Webbof an algorithm that is known to perform well in practice but has poor worst-case complexity. The simplex algorithm solves a linear program, for example, of the form, max cT x subject to Ax ≤b, (1) where A is an m×n matrix, b is an m-place vector, and c is an n-place vector. In the worst case, the simplex algorithm takes exponential time [25]. Webb17 jan. 2024 · Time complexity represents the number of times a statement is executed. The time complexity of an algorithm is NOT the actual time required to execute a particular code, since that depends on other factors like programming language, operating software, processing power, etc.

Webb10 aug. 2024 · Algorithm. getMax (arr, n): index := 0 max := arr [0] for i in range 1 to n - 1, do if arr [i] > max, then max := arr [i] index := i end if done return index. We have to choose those operations that are performed maximum amount of time to estimate the cost. Suppose we have one bubble sort algorithm, and we count the swap operation. WebbThe simplex algorithm is a very efficient algorithm in practice, and it is one of the dominant algorithms for linear programming in practice. On practical problems, the number of …

Webb17 sep. 2024 · Even if extremely powerful, the Simplex algorithm suffers of one initialization issue: its starting point must be a feasible basic solution of the problem to solve. To overcome it, two approaches may be used: the two-phases method and the Big-M method, both presenting positive and negative aspects. Webb• reliable and efficient algorithms and software • computation time proportional to n2k (A ∈ Rk×n); less if structured • a mature technology using least-squares • least-squares problems are easy to recognize • a few standard techniques increase flexibility (e.g., including weights, adding regularization terms) Introduction 1–5

Webb21 okt. 2011 · The Nelder-Mead algorithm or simplex search algorithm, originally published in 1965 (Nelder and Mead, 1965), is one of the best known algorithms for multidimensional unconstrained optimization without derivatives. This method should not be confused with Dantzig's simplex method for linear programming, which is completely …

WebbReviewer 3 Summary. This paper proposes a new algorithm for (correlated) topic modeling that works without the anchor-words assumption. The main idea of the algorithm is based on minimizing the determinant of a "topic-topic correlation" matrix, which is related to the idea of minimizing the volume of the simplex (but different because it works on the topic … order by zomatoWebbIn 1984, Narendra Karmarkar developed a method for linear programming called Karmarkar's algorithm, which runs in provably polynomial time and is also very efficient … irc orange countyWebbCOMPUTATIONAL COMPLEXITY OF THE SIMPLEX ALGORITHM KARMARKAR’S PROJECTIVE ALGORITHM In 1984 Karmarkar (AT&T Bell Laboratories) proposed a new … order by 和 whereWebb10 apr. 2024 · The Arithmetic Optimization Algorithm (AOA) [35] is a recently proposed MH inspired by the primary arithmetic operator’s distribution action mathematical equations. It is a population-based global optimization algorithm initially explored for numerous unimodal, multimodal, composite, and hybrid test functions, along with a few real-world … order by と whereWebb1. If x is optimal and non-degenerate, then c¯≥ 0. 2. If ¯c≥ 0, then x is optimal. Proof: To prove 1, observe that if ¯cj < 0, then moving in the direction of the corre- sponding d reduces the objective function. To prove 2, let y be an arbitrary feasible solution, and define d = y − x.Then Ad = 0, implying BdB +NdN = 0, and dB = −B 1NdN.Now we can … order by 和 unionWebbEven some interior-point methods (e.g. Karmarkar's algorithm) have poly-time bounds ( en.wikipedia.org/wiki/Karmarkar%27s_algorithm) And of course the Ellipsoid method … order by yearWebbขั้นตอนวิธีซิมเพล็กซ์ (อังกฤษ: simplex algorithm) หรือ วิธีซิมเพล็กซ์ (อังกฤษ: simplex method) จะอาศัยหลักการของเมทริกซ์เข้าช่วยในการหาผลลัพธ์ที่เหมาะสมที่สุด ... irc osb sheathing